Categories and Privileges

Regular APCLAO Membership
Regular APCLAO membership is open to ophthalmologists who have completed a specialist training in Ophthalmology from a recognized institution and has a minimum of 3 years of contact lens fitting experience.

Regular APCLAO Members shall enjoy the following privileges:

  • Advocacy for contact lens subspecialty and its related field generally leading to invitations to speak at scientific meetings, symposia and conferences.
  • Opportunities for collaborative research projects and access to research information.
  • Privilege to patient cross-referral and follow-up care network.
  • Priority to education and training expertise.
  • A rebate of an amount equivalent to the subscription fees paid by a Regular APCLAO member provided the member attends one APCLAO Scientific Meeting held during the membership period.
  • Possible reduced registration fees at other regional ophthalmic meetings.
  • Membership Certificate upon approval by APCLAO Board of Officers.

Associate APCLAO Membership
Associate APCLAO Membership is open to all certified ophthalmologists, physicians, paramedical, professionals and scientists involved in the field of ophthalmology and visual sciences.

Associate APCLAO Members shall enjoy the following privileges:

  • Opportunities for collaborative research projects and access to research information.
  • Privilege to patient cross-referral and follow-up care network.
  • A rebate of an amount equivalent to the subscription fees paid by a Associate APCLAO member provided the member attends one APCLAO Scientific Meeting held during the membership period.
  • Possible reduced registration fees at other regional ophthalmic meetings.

Members-In-Training Membership
Members-In-Training membership is open to all ophthalmologists in training and must be proposed by and seconded by existing Regular Members.

Members-In-Training shall enjoy the following privileges:

  • Opportunities for collaborative research projects and access to research information.
  • Privilege to patient cross-referral and follow-up care network.
  • Possible reduced registration fees at other regional ophthalmic meetings.

Corporate APCLAO Membership
Corporate Membership is open to any corporation that manufactures, sells, or provides services or products related to the medical or ophthalmic field, including the visual sciences and institutions and universities that participate in these areas. A new Corporate APCLAO Member must be proposed by one (1) Regular Member of the APLCAO

Subscription Fees and Application Form

Regular Member – USD50.00 for two years

Associate Member – USD50.00 for two years

Members-In-Training – USD30.00 for two years
